Hancock went 5-5 last year. Went 5-3 the year before - and they play Rappanhanock and MMA every year (possibly two of the worst football teams in the state). Hancock is currently 0-3 this year.

FCS was very good a few years ago. Way down now with recent changes. FCS went 0-8 last year according to Maxpreps and they are currently 1-2 this current season. So neither Hancock nor FCS can be considered a quality win at this point.

Then, for Quantico's schedule, throw in KF and BA (two programs struggling just to field teams that might win a couple games at most this year), and throw in a few homeschool teams that give no VISAA points, and really the only game on their schedule that will test them is Richmond Christian.

Agree that it's nice to see Quantico have some success. On the other hand, it seems counter-intuitive to put together a creampuff schedule to hopefully make it to the playoffs but then get blown out in the first round because your team hasn't been tested on a consistent basis.
